Output 580fe391ccb395c37eb6ead8c2766c1284efb8eba77c5a29b764429b1c33748a:48

value
25035234
script pubkey
OP_0 OP_PUSHBYTES_32 0f6a7be8c21ac1483a96db391c26f26299a050fdb2416086d2ae4df53b3b33a7
address
bc1qpa48h6xzrtq5sw5kmvu3cfhjv2v6q58akfqkppkj4exl2wemxwnszaqafq
transaction
580fe391ccb395c37eb6ead8c2766c1284efb8eba77c5a29b764429b1c33748a
spent
true